It appears that Grace Dent is set to be joined by a fresh face in the MasterChef kitchen this year.

The BBC has confirmed that Michelin-starred, award-winning chef Giorgio Locatelli is the newest judge to come aboard the celebrity edition of the programme.

That said, Giorgio is no stranger to the much-loved series, having served as a judge on the Italian version of MasterChef since 2018.

Reflecting on his new role, Giorgio said: “Hosting Celebrity MasterChef alongside Grace is a real honour.

“I can’t wait for you to see what our celebrity contestants bring to the kitchen, as we are really putting their culinary skills to the test in this series.”

Meanwhile, his new co-presenter had only glowing words when discussing Giorgio’s arrival on Celebrity MasterChef, reports Wales Online.

Grace Dent said: “Giorgio Locatelli is a fabulous addition to our UK Celebrity MasterChef team. I’m a long-time admirer of his work and was a huge fan of Locanda Locatelli; for many years, it was one of my happy places to eat.

“I couldn’t be happier to combine our shared joy, passion, and expertise for food. I also love an opportunity to serve up a heavy dose of glamour in the MasterChef kitchen, and I have a feeling Giorgio is going to give me a real run for my money.”

Giorgio’s career stretches across a remarkable four decades, and he is widely regarded as one of the finest and most celebrated chefs in the UK. The 63-year-old first received a Michelin star back in 1999, going on to earn a second just four years later in 2003.

The BBC has confirmed that the new series will make its return this summer, with a fresh lineup of famous faces set to battle it out in the kitchen against one another.

Fans will have to sit tight a little longer, however, before finding out which celebrities will be stepping up to the plate and following in the footsteps of last year’s winner, RuPaul’s Drag Race UK star Ginger Johnson.

Giorgio is the latest addition to the judging panel on the BBC programme, following the dismissal of John Torode after an allegation against him using “an extremely offensive racist term” was upheld.

Addressing his departure at the time on Instagram, he said: “Although I haven’t heard from anyone at the BBC or Banijay, I am seeing and reading that I’ve been ‘sacked’ from MasterChef. I repeat that I have no recollection of what I’m accused of. The enquiry could not even state the date or year of when I am meant to have said something wrong.”

He subsequently added: “Personally, I have loved every minute working on MasterChef, but it’s time to pass the cutlery to someone else. For whoever takes over, love it as I have.”
